Hello, I have a chartbook set up with all of my preferences and charts ready with everything I currently look at for CL. I want to add the ES with the same exact settings but I don't want to have to redo all of my settings and charts all over again for the ES. Would it be possible to somehow just load the ES into my current chartbook settings so I don't have to redo everything? Thanks
|
[2021-09-23 15:23:03] |
John - SC Support - Posts: 40645 |
The easiest thing is to create a new Chartbook for the ES and then in the old chartbook select Chart >> Duplicate All Charts to Chartbook and specify the new chartbook as the destination. Refer to the following information: Chart Menu: Duplicate All Charts to Chartbook (Chart menu) Once all the charts are copied, then you can just update the symbol for each of the charts in the new Chartbook. If you already have the charts linked to use the same symbol, then you can just change the symbol of one chart and all the rest will update.
